Subject: [PATCH v2 1/3] iommu: amd: Use 4K page for completion wait write-back semaphore

IOMMU SNP support requires the completion wait write-back semaphore to be
implemented using a 4K-aligned page, where the page address is to be
programmed into the newly introduced MMIO base/range registers.

This new scheme uses a per-iommu atomic variable to store the current
semaphore value, which is incremented for every completion wait command.

Since this new scheme is also compatible with non-SNP mode,
generalize the driver to use 4K page for completion-wait semaphore in
both modes.

 drivers/iommu/amd/amd_iommu_types.h |  3 ++-
 drivers/iommu/amd/init.c            | 18 ++++++++++++++++++
 drivers/iommu/amd/iommu.c           | 23 +++++++++++------------
 3 files changed, 31 insertions(+), 13 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/iommu/amd/amd_iommu_types.h b/drivers/iommu/amd/amd_iommu_types.h
index 30a5d412255a..4c80483e78ec 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/amd/amd_iommu_types.h
+++ b/drivers/iommu/amd/amd_iommu_types.h
@@ -595,7 +595,8 @@ struct amd_iommu {
 #endif
 
 	u32 flags;
-	volatile u64 __aligned(8) cmd_sem;
+	volatile u64 *cmd_sem;
+	u64 cmd_sem_val;
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_AMD_IOMMU_DEBUGFS
 	/* DebugFS Info */
diff --git a/drivers/iommu/amd/init.c b/drivers/iommu/amd/init.c
index 445a08d23fed..febc072f2717 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/amd/init.c
+++ b/drivers/iommu/amd/init.c
@@ -813,6 +813,19 @@ static int iommu_init_ga(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
 	return ret;
 }
 
+static int __init alloc_cwwb_sem(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
+{
+	iommu->cmd_sem = (void *)get_zeroed_page(GFP_KERNEL);
+
+	return iommu->cmd_sem ? 0 : -ENOMEM;
+}
+
+static void __init free_cwwb_sem(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
+{
+	if (iommu->cmd_sem)
+		free_page((unsigned long)iommu->cmd_sem);
+}
+
 static void iommu_enable_xt(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
 {
 #ifdef CONFIG_IRQ_REMAP
@@ -1395,6 +1408,7 @@ static int __init init_iommu_from_acpi(struct amd_iommu *iommu,
 
 static void __init free_iommu_one(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
 {
+	free_cwwb_sem(iommu);
 	free_command_buffer(iommu);
 	free_event_buffer(iommu);
 	free_ppr_log(iommu);
@@ -1481,6 +1495,7 @@ static int __init init_iommu_one(struct amd_iommu *iommu, struct ivhd_header *h)
 	int ret;
 
 	raw_spin_lock_init(&iommu->lock);
+	iommu->cmd_sem_val = 0;
 
 	/* Add IOMMU to internal data structures */
 	list_add_tail(&iommu->list, &amd_iommu_list);
@@ -1558,6 +1573,9 @@ static int __init init_iommu_one(struct amd_iommu *iommu, struct ivhd_header *h)
 	if (!iommu->mmio_base)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
+	if (alloc_cwwb_sem(iommu))
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
 	if (alloc_command_buffer(iommu))
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
diff --git a/drivers/iommu/amd/iommu.c b/drivers/iommu/amd/iommu.c
index 10e4200d3552..9e9898683537 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/amd/iommu.c
+++ b/drivers/iommu/amd/iommu.c
@@ -792,11 +792,11 @@ irqreturn_t amd_iommu_int_handler(int irq, void *data)
  *
  ****************************************************************************/
 
-static int wait_on_sem(volatile u64 *sem)
+static int wait_on_sem(struct amd_iommu *iommu, u64 data)
 {
 	int i = 0;
 
-	while (*sem == 0 && i < LOOP_TIMEOUT) {
+	while (*iommu->cmd_sem != data && i < LOOP_TIMEOUT) {
 		udelay(1);
 		i += 1;
 	}
@@ -827,16 +827,16 @@ static void copy_cmd_to_buffer(struct amd_iommu *iommu,
 	writel(tail, iommu->mmio_base + MMIO_CMD_TAIL_OFFSET);
 }
 
-static void build_completion_wait(struct iommu_cmd *cmd, u64 address)
+static void build_completion_wait(struct iommu_cmd *cmd,
+				  struct amd_iommu *iommu,
+				  u64 data)
 {
-	u64 paddr = iommu_virt_to_phys((void *)address);
-
-	WARN_ON(address & 0x7ULL);
+	u64 paddr = iommu_virt_to_phys((void *)iommu->cmd_sem);
 
 	memset(cmd, 0, sizeof(*cmd));
 	cmd->data[0] = lower_32_bits(paddr) | CMD_COMPL_WAIT_STORE_MASK;
 	cmd->data[1] = upper_32_bits(paddr);
-	cmd->data[2] = 1;
+	cmd->data[2] = data;
 	CMD_SET_TYPE(cmd, CMD_COMPL_WAIT);
 }
 
@@ -1045,22 +1045,21 @@ static int iommu_completion_wait(struct amd_iommu *iommu)
 	struct iommu_cmd cmd;
 	unsigned long flags;
 	int ret;
+	u64 data;
 
 	if (!iommu->need_sync)
 		return 0;
 
-
-	build_completion_wait(&cmd, (u64)&iommu->cmd_sem);
-
 	raw_spin_lock_irqsave(&iommu->lock, flags);
 
-	iommu->cmd_sem = 0;
+	data = ++iommu->cmd_sem_val;
+	build_completion_wait(&cmd, iommu, data);
 
 	ret = __iommu_queue_command_sync(iommu, &cmd, false);
 	if (ret)
 		goto out_unlock;
 
-	ret = wait_on_sem(&iommu->cmd_sem);
+	ret = wait_on_sem(iommu, data);
 
 out_unlock:
 	raw_spin_unlock_irqrestore(&iommu->lock, flags);
